The History and Myth Behind the Drinking Age on Cruises if You're 18

The history of the drinking age on cruises if you're 18 is influenced by various factors, including international laws, cultural norms, and the policies of individual cruise lines. In many countries, the legal drinking age is lower than 21, which may explain why some cruise lines allow 18-year-olds to consume alcohol in certain circumstances.

However, it's essential to understand that the drinking age on a cruise ship is ultimately determined by the cruise line itself. Each cruise line has the authority to set its own policies and guidelines regarding alcohol consumption. These policies may be influenced by factors such as the cruise line's target demographic, the countries the ship visits, and the legal requirements of the ship's flag state.

There is a common myth that the drinking age on cruises is 18 because the ship operates in international waters. While it is true that cruise ships are subject to different regulations when they are in international waters, this does not necessarily mean that the drinking age is automatically 18. It is crucial to research and understand the specific policies of the cruise line you plan to sail with to avoid any misunderstandings or legal issues.

The Hidden Secrets of the Drinking Age on Cruises if You're 18

While there are no hidden secrets when it comes to the drinking age on cruises if you're 18, there are a few things to keep in mind. Firstly, it's important to note that even if a cruise line allows 18-year-olds to consume alcohol, there may still be restrictions on where and when you can drink. Some cruise lines may only allow alcohol consumption in certain areas of the ship or during specific times.

Additionally, it's crucial to remember that even if a cruise line has a minimum drinking age of 18, they may still enforce stricter policies on specific sailings or itineraries. For example, if the cruise is visiting countries with a higher legal drinking age, the cruise line may require passengers to adhere to the higher age limit while in those ports of call.

It's always best to check with the cruise line directly to ensure you have a clear understanding of their policies and any potential restrictions or limitations before embarking on your cruise.
